This is the opportunity of a lifetime to see incredible wild animals living free in the myriad of habitats in the Western Ghats. We will cover 2000 kilometres across various ecosystems and seeing a wide variety of mammals, birds, amphibians, reptiles, insects, spiders, gastropods, fungi and myriapods.

The Western Ghats region is a biodiversity hotspot. It contains a large number of different species of flora and fauna, most of which are endemic to this region. At least 325 globally threatened species occur in the Western Ghats. The region was declared as a UNESCO World Heritage Site in 2012. Also called the Sahyadri, this ancient mountain range is the eighth most bio-diverse region on earth.

Giving Back – Our Conservation Pledge2026-04-15T23:59:11+00:00

Munnar’s shola forests, interspersed with tea, cardamom, and coffee plantations, host several critically endangered frog species. However, habitat-disturbing practices and pesticide use, fuelled by local myths, have led to a decline in many of the species’ populations.

To address this, Hadlee and his team at Resplendent Experiences focused on conserving these frogs at Windermere Cardamom Plantation. They constructed water habitats (WHs) tailored for frog breeding, using native plants like wild turmeric and ferns to recreate suitable nesting environments. Their efforts proved successful, with frogs adapting to the habitats.

The team has demonstrated that even small initiatives can have a substantial impact on conservation efforts. The project has heightened awareness about the presence of various endemic frog species in Munnar. By raising awareness and educating the public about the importance of these often-overlooked species, the team has fostered a sense of responsibility and care for the natural world among the local community and beyond. Their dedication to the cause has inspired others to join the movement, further strengthening the efforts to protect and conserve the unique biodiversity of Munnar.

A percentage of profits from each Safari is donated to Resplendent Experiences to produce some more of these Frog Ponds in some suitable areas to assist with the conservation of the many vulnerable frogs.
